A Newfoundland man who evaded police for years has been brought back to Ontario to face charges in a break and enter and several other offences.
Police say Donald Mugford, 44, is accused in a 2009 break and enter in Milton, Ont., and they suspect he may also be behind other break-ins in Halton Region.
They say he is also wanted by provincial police, Toronto police and police in Peel Region on multiple offences, including theft over $5,000, theft under $5,000, break and enter, dangerous operation of a motor vehicle and breach of probation.
Police say Mugford was arrested during a traffic stop in Newfoundland on July 28.
Halton officers charged him Monday and have since returned him to Ontario, where he'll face all outstanding charges against him.
